Responsibilities

  • Design and implement quantum machine learning algorithms leveraging Q# and TensorFlow Quantum frameworks
  • Develop novel error-correction techniques for quantum neural networks
  • Collaborate with quantum hardware engineers to optimize AI models for quantum processors
  • Lead cross-functional projects integrating quantum AI solutions into commercial applications
  • Publish breakthrough research in top-tier journals and present at international conferences
  • Mentor junior researchers and contribute to patent development
  • Stay ahead of emerging quantum AI standards and regulatory frameworks

Qualifications

  • PhD in Quantum Computing, Machine Learning, or related field (or equivalent experience)
  • Expertise in quantum algorithms and quantum circuit design
  • Proficiency in Python, Q#, and quantum computing libraries (Cirq, PennyLane)
  • Proven track record of publishing in quantum AI or machine learning
  • Experience with hybrid quantum-classical frameworks
  • Strong background in linear algebra, probability theory, and information theory
  • Demonstrated ability to translate complex research into practical applications
